Proportion of primary schools with access to computers for in U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ific
U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ific: Proportion of primary schools with access to computers for was 56.7% in 2024. ▼ Falling
Proportion of primary schools with access to computers for in U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ific, 2015–2024
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in %.
Analysis
The most recent figure for proportion of primary schools with access to computers for in U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ific is 56.7%, measured in 2024.
The figure is up 0.5% on the previous year and down 6.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, proportion of primary schools with access to computers for in U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ific peaked at 65.8% in 2018 and was at its lowest, 56.4%, in 2023.
That places U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ific 77th out of 151 groups with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.
Proportion of primary schools with access to computers for in U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ific, year by year
| Year | % |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2015 | 60.6% | — |
| 2016 | 60.1% | -0.9% |
| 2017 | 63.1% | +4.9% |
| 2018 | 65.8% | +4.4% |
| 2019 | 64.2% | -2.4% |
| 2020 | 62.8% | -2.2% |
| 2021 | 61.0% | -2.8% |
| 2022 | 58.1% | -4.8% |
| 2023 | 56.4% | -2.9% |
| 2024 | 56.7% | +0.5% |
